Westbrook: The championship has always been my goal, the Wizards have a great chance of winning_Washington

Original title: Westbrook: The championship has always been my goal. The Wizards have a great chance of winning

On December 6, Beijing time, reports from the US media said that in an interview today, Wizards star Russell Westbrook stated that his goal has always been to compete for the championship.

From Houston to Washington, Westbrook’s goal has not changed. “My goal is to win the championship. Yes, the chances are really great in Washington (to win),” Westbrook said. “This is a great city, but Washington has not yet achieved satisfactory results. I really In my opinion, there is a great chance of winning in the Wizards, and my goal is always to beat the other 29 opponents in the league.”

Westbrook has won the regular season MVP and has also averaged a triple-double in the season. So, not having a championship is his only regret in his current career?

“To be honest, I don’t agree. I have different views on how to define a career,” Westbrook said. “From my personal point of view, what I care about is my contribution to the community and whether I can inspire others. The expectation of basketball is to influence other people and give them strength.”

Has Westbrook’s basketball style changed? “You have to ask Coach (Scott) Brooks about this, because I worked with him for a long time when I was young,” Westbrook said. “My style of playing is to fight. On the court, my goal is to beat. Bian opponent. This is my style and it will not change.”

Westbrook did not respond positively, whether he voluntarily applied to leave the Rockets. “I am in Washington now and I like where I am now,” Westbrook said. “I know this is a brand new journey.”
